Carspotting and car street photography are two related but distinct practices that have gained popularity in recent years. Carspotting involves the art of spotting rare or interesting cars on the street, while car street photography is the art of capturing stunning photos of cars in public spaces. Both practices require a keen eye for detail and a passion for cars, but they differ in their approach and purpose.

 

In this article, we’ll explore the differences between carspotting and car street photography and discuss the techniques and ethics involved in each practice.

 

Carspotting is the act of spotting unique, rare, and exotic cars on the street. The goal of carspotting is to find cars that are not commonly seen on the road and take pictures of them. Carspotting enthusiasts are always on the lookout for cars that are rare, expensive, or have unique features.

 

The practice of carspotting is not limited to a specific location or country. It is a global phenomenon that attracts car enthusiasts from different parts of the world. In fact, there are several online communities and forums dedicated to carspotting, where enthusiasts share their findings, tips, and experiences.

 

On the other hand, car street photography is the art of capturing cars in their natural environment, on the street. It involves taking pictures of cars as they pass by, or capturing them parked on the street. Car street photography is not limited to any specific type of car. It can be any car, from classic cars to modern supercars.

 

Car street photography requires skill and patience. Photographers need to be quick to capture the moment, and they also need to have a good eye for composition. The goal of car street photography is to capture the beauty and uniqueness of the car, as well as its surroundings.

The Art of Carspotting:

 

Carspotting is a unique hobby that has gained a large following in recent years. Whether you’re a car enthusiast or a photography enthusiast, carspotting can be a fun and rewarding activity.

 

One of the key techniques used by carspotters is to research popular spots where rare or interesting cars are likely to be found. This might involve scouring online forums, social media groups, or simply spending time in areas known for high-end or exotic cars. It’s important to remember that while carspotting can be exciting, it’s also important to respect the privacy and property of car owners. Many carspotters use discretion when sharing photos of cars online, taking care not to reveal identifying information or locations.

In addition to appreciating the beauty of cars and capturing them in their natural environment, carspotting and car street photography have other benefits as well.

 

Firstly, these trends allow photographers to improve their skills. Both carspotting and car street photography require quick reflexes and an eye for detail. Photographers need to be able to identify interesting cars and capture them in a way that highlights their unique features.

 

This requires practice and patience, and over time, photographers can develop their skills and become more proficient at capturing cars on the street.

 

Secondly, carspotting and car street photography can be a great way to connect with other car enthusiasts.

 

There are several online communities and forums dedicated to these trends, where enthusiasts can share their findings, tips, and experiences. This allows photographers to connect with others who share their passion for cars and photography, and can lead to new friendships and collaborations.

 

Finally, carspotting and car street photography can be a great way to document the history of cars. Many cars that are spotted on the street are rare or unique, and may not be seen again.

 

By capturing these cars in photographs, photographers are preserving their history for future generations to appreciate. In addition, car street photography can document the changing landscape of a city, as cars are an integral part of the urban environment.

However, it is important to note that carspotting and car street photography should always be done in a safe and responsible manner.

 

Photographers should never put themselves or others in danger while attempting to capture a photograph. They should also respect the privacy of car owners, and never take pictures of people without their permission.
